      RS 15:325     

  

CHAPTER 1-B.  SENTENCING POLICY: USE OF RISK AND NEEDS

ASSESSMENT AND EVALUATION TOOL

§325.  Twenty-Second Judicial District Court; sentencing policy

It is the sentencing policy of the Twenty-Second Judicial District Court that the primary objective of sentencing shall be to maintain public safety, hold offenders accountable, reduce recidivism and criminal behavior, and improve potential outcomes for those offenders who are sentenced.  Reduction of recidivism and criminal behavior is a key measure of the performance of the criminal justice system.

Acts 2013, No. 347, §1.
